Is 815 893 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 815 893 is about 903.268.

Thus, the square root of 815 893 is not an integer, and therefore 815 893 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 815 893?

The square of a number (here 815 893) is the result of the product of this number (815 893) by itself (i.e., 815 893 × 815 893); the square of 815 893 is sometimes called "raising 815 893 to the power 2", or "815 893 squared".

The square of 815 893 is 665 681 387 449 because 815 893 × 815 893 = 815 8932 = 665 681 387 449.

As a consequence, 815 893 is the square root of 665 681 387 449.
